- The distance between Villa Reynolds, Argentina and Tecumseh, Ne, Usa is approximately 8,781 km or 5,457 mi.
- To reach Villa Reynolds in this distance one would set out from Tecumseh, Ne bearing 154.4° or SSE and follow the great circles arc to approach Villa Reynolds bearing 156.6° or SSE .
- Villa Reynolds has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Tecumseh, Ne has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a).
- Villa Reynolds is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ome whereas Tecumseh, Ne is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 5.5 °C (9.9°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 15.5 °C (27.9°F) less in Villa Reynolds.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 141.4 mm (5.6 in) less which is equivalent to 141.4 l/m² (3.47 US gal/ft²) or 1,414,000 l/ha (151,166 US gal/ac) less. About 5/6 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 5.6° higher in Villa Reynolds than in Tecumseh, Ne.
